How do you cook your sweet potatoes?
Brittany Dixon says
Scrub the potato and pat dry. Then, poke with a fork a few times. Put it in the oven at 425 for 40-60 minutes, until it is soft when you squeeze it. Sometimes I will wrap it in foil to keep the sweet oozings from getting all over the place!
